What to Give Your Initial Meeting



When you walk right into your first conference with a separation attorney, bringing the appropriate documents can make a substantial difference in the effectiveness of your assessment.

Start by gathering economic statements, including checking account information, income tax return, and pay stubs. These will assist your attorney understand your monetary scenario.

Additionally, bring any kind of pertinent legal papers, such as marital relationship certificates or prenuptial contracts.

If there are youngsters included, prepare wardship arrangements, school records, and medical details.

It's likewise practical to jot down notes regarding your goals and concerns concerning the Divorce.

Having this info on hand will allow your attorney to give customized advice and assist you browse the process more effectively.

Being ready collections the tone for an efficient meeting.

Comprehending the Divorce Process and Your Alternatives



Divorce can feel frustrating, specifically if you're not sure concerning the procedure and your alternatives. Comprehending the actions included can alleviate your stress and anxiety.

You have alternatives, as well. Consider mediation if you want a less adversarial approach. Collaborative Divorce is one more choice, permitting both parties to interact with their lawyers.

If you and your partner can't agree, litigation might be essential, where a judge makes the decisions. By knowing these choices, you can take control of your scenario and make informed choices that fit your demands.
